Madrid citizens can now make their tax declarations at special municipal bureaus thanks to an agreement between the city council and the state tax office, the Agencia Estatal de Administracin Tributaria (AEAT). As of mid-April, community cultural centres in the south-eastern districts of Usera, Viclvaro and San Blas now house an office with personnel trained to help citizens prepare and present their tax forms. The Madrid City council has invested nearly 139,000 in computers and IT personnel for the scheme, which aims to benefit about 27,000 Madrid residents. Appointments can be made by phoning 901 22 33 44. The new offices are in:

Centro Cultural Antonio Machado, 20 calle de Arcos de Jaln (San Blas); Centro Cultural Orcasur, 2 plaza de Pueblo Nuevo (Usera); Centro Cultural El Madroo, calle de Villardondiego, s/n (Viclvaro); Junta Municipal de Usera, 41 Rafaela Ybarra; and Oficina de Atencin al Contribuyente, 45 calle de Alcal.
